Simulation – tips for junior doctors
Jessica Stokes-Paris, an ICU RN and Assistant Professor at Bond University with a PhD in medical education, discusses the transformative power of simulation in medical training. She emphasizes how simulation creates a safe space for junior doctors to learn and make mistakes. Key topics include establishing effective simulation programs, the importance of debriefing for learning, and bridging the gap between practice and real-world application. Stokes-Paris also highlights the role of teamwork and innovative learning strategies in enhancing medical education outcomes.
